Gaza is now under siege as the Israeli military is retaliating to the surprise attack by Hamas militants.

The conflict is now the focus of the world and has caused almost 2,000 deaths on both sides, including children, and more injured and kidnapped.It has now been four days since the fighting started, and the war between Israel and Hamas has now claimed at least 1,900 lives. On the Israeli side, civilians are now sharing their stories.

"We're still processing it. There's no going back from this. How can we go back to live in that beautiful place when we know what happened there and all the people that we knew that we saw on the pavements every day going from the kindergarten and back then, how can we just keep going on like nothing ever happened? And at this point, I'm in a numb state and I'm just disconnected from everything.

As the conflict becomes the focus of the world, the United States is reacting. President Joe Biden has decided to send Secretary of State Antony Blinken to the region, a strong sign, as Mr Blinken is the country's top diplomat. "This was an act of sheer evil. Civilians slaughtered. Not just killed, slaughtered. Among them at least 14 American citizens killed. Parents butchered, using their bodies to try to protect their children, entire families slain. Young people massacred while attending a musical festival to celebrate peace. Families hid their fear for hours and hours, desperately trying to keep their children quiet, to avoid drawing attention. You all know these traumas never go away.
